Swisslog Names Colman Roche as VP, Customer Service Account Management

Colman Roche

Swisslog made a smart move by tapping Colman Roche for Vice President of Customer Service Account Management. This highlights their commitment to boosting customer experience and fostering long-term relationships, which will amp up their service quality.

In this new gig, Roche will zero in on ramping up service delivery throughout the system’s lifecycle. Plus, he’ll help customers get maximum value from their ops, so everyone wins. Plus, he’ll back growth in both warehouse automation and software. With over 30 years in supply chain and automation, Colman brings loads of experience. He led several projects on automation and software rollouts. Also, Colman improved processes and made ops way more efficient.

“Colman’s appointment reflects our continued focus on strengthening the customer experience as a core part of our growth strategy. His leadership brings a thoughtful, long‑term approach to the customer that supports stronger partnerships and helps partners achieve sustained operational improvements,” said Mike Barker, President and CEO of Swisslog Americas.

Driving Growth Through Leadership and Industry Expertise

Colman joined Swisslog in 2019 as Vice President of Sales and Consulting, and he helped expand their e-grocery fulfillment strategy. Then, he became the Vice President of AutoStore Sales in the Americas, driving commercial growth across different industries. He was focused on enhancing productivity, inventory density, and operational flexibility. Thus, his experience bolsters Swisslog’s service offerings.
